In order to study the interpersonal relations in the class team, we conducted the methodology "Study of the psychological climate in the group" proposed by F.Fidler among 32 students of the 4th grade of the 6th secondary school of Fergana city (1 -diagram). 1-diagram 1 0 0 0 9 3 .7 5 6 .2 5 9 0 .6 2 5 9 .3 7 5 8 7 .5 1 2 .5 9 0 .6 2 5 9 .3 7 5 8 4 .3 7 5 1 5 .6 2 5 9 6 .8 7 5 3 .1 2 5 8 7 .5 1 2 .5 9 0 .6 2 5 9 .3 7 5 8 7 .5 1 2 .5 GURUHDAGI PSIXOLOGIK IQLIMNI O`RGANISH American Journal of Interdisciplinary Research and Development ISSN Online: 2771-8948 Website: www.ajird.journalspark.org Volume 11, Dec., 2022 343 | P a g e Analyzing this table, 32, i.e. 100% of the students said that "Friendliness" is characteristic of the first scale, 30 out of 32, i.e. 93.75% of the students were of the second scale. According to "Agreement", 2 people, i.e. 6.25 percent of test takers, characterized "Disagreement", 29 out of 32 people, i.e. 90.625 percent test takers, according to the third scale "Satisfaction with peers", 3 people, i.e. 9,375 100 percent of the test subjects have the characteristic of "Dissatisfaction with classmates", 28 out of 32, i.e. 87.5 percent of the test subjects have the characteristic "Interest in group work" according to the fourth scale, 4 of them, i.e. 12.5 percent of the test subjects have the characteristic "Indifference to group work". 29 out of 32 people, i.e. 90.625 percent of the test subjects, on the fifth scale "Protecting each other", 3 people, i.e. 9.375 percent of the test subjects "Not protecting each other", 27 out of 32 people, i.e. 84.375 percent of the test subjects 15.625 percent of the test takers have the characteristic of "Incoherence, inconsistency" according to the sixth scale, 5 people, i.e. 15.625 percent, 31 out of 32 people, i.e. 96.875 percent of the test takers, according to the seventh scale, "Cooperation, like-mindedness", 1 person i.e. 3.125 percent of the test takers "Distrust each other", 28 out of 32 test takers i.e. 87.5 percent test take "Mutual help" according to the eighth scale, 4 test takers i.e. 12.5 percent test take "Goodness" 29 out of 32 people, i.e. 90.625 percent of test takers, have "Respect for group mates" according to the ninth scale, 3 people, i.e. 9.375 percent of test takers, have "Disrespect for group mates", 28 out of 32 people have 87.5 percent of the test takers on the tenth scale rated "Rejoicing at the achievement of a group member", 4 people, i.e. 12.5 percent of the test subjects, assessed the characteristic of "Indifference to the achievement of a group member".
